Options for FMGE Failed Medical Graduates in 2025

After failing the FMGE exam, students generally have four primary options to further pursue a career or education with their MBBS degrees. Here are these options for FMGE failed medical graduates:

Reappear for the FMGE exam.

The FMGE exam is conducted twice a year. The first session takes place in July and the other one in December. If candidates fail to pass the FMGE exam in one session, they can appear for the next FMGE session with better preparation. Often, the majority of medical graduates pass the FMGE in multiple attempts. Hence, students must not be disheartened if they fail. They can analyse the reasons why they have failed the first time, use official study material, practice consistently, and use other techniques.

Alternative Career Options

If candidates fail to pass the FMGE exam, then they are not allowed to practice medicine in India. However, they can pursue several other including medical, clinical, para-clinical, education, and other allied medical job roles. Students can read here, jobs for FMGE failed students, for more details.

Postgraduation Abroad Options

Another option for students after failing the FMGE exam is to pursue a postgraduate degree abroad after completing their MBBS. Generally, an FMGE qualification is not required to be eligible for these courses, such as MHA, MPH, Clinical diploma, etc.

Medical Research Programs Abroad

Candidates can also pursue medical research programs such as Department of Health Research (DHR) Fellowships, ICMR Fellowships Abroad, Global Health Leaders Research Internships, etc. These research fellowships offer medical graduates with hands-on experience, cultural differences in medical industries, global exposure, and networking.

Top PG Courses Abroad Without FMGE in 2025

Medical graduates after completing MBBS abroad often fail the FMGE exam because of its high difficulty level, less preparation, unfamiliar examination pattern, and many other reasons. One of the alternative pathways for FMGE failed students is to pursue a postgraduate course abroad, as these offer them global opportunities in the medical industry.

Several top countries for a medical PG abroad without FMGE qualification include UK, USA, Canada, Australia, and several EU countries. After completion of such medical MS and diploma, it opens doors to a lucrative career in fields such as healthcare, research, public health, and allied sciences. Let us discuss some of the top postgraduate courses abroad without FMGE in 2025 for medical aspirants:

Master’s in Hospital Administration (MHA)

Particulars

Details

Eligibility

  • Graduation with at least 50% GPA in a health-related degree such as BPharm, BE, BTech, BSc, etc.

  • 2-3 years of work experience (If required)

  • GRE score of 150+ (If required)

  • English proficiency (IELTS/PTE/DET/TOEFL)

  • Additional documents (SOP, LOR, resume)


Course duration

2 years

Top specialisations

  • Hospital Administration

  • Financial Administration

  • Human Resources System Analysis

  • Human Resources in Healthcare

Top job roles

  • Hospital Administrator

  • Operations Head

  • Quality Manager

Master of Public Health (MPH)

Particulars

Details

Eligibility

  • A bachelor's degree in health related field such as biology, psychology, sociology, or public health.

  • A minimum GPA of 3.0 on a 4.0 scale is often considered to be competitive for admission in MPH courses abroad.

  • English proficiency (DET/TOEFL/PTE/IELTS)

  • Additional documents (LOR, SOP, resume)

  • A research proposal (If required)

Course duration

2 years

Top specialisations

  • Environmental Health

  • Epidemiology

  • Biostatistics

Top job roles

  • Public Health Officer

  • Health Policy Analyst

  • NGO Program Manager

Postgraduate Diploma in Clinical Research

Particulars

Details

Eligibility

  • Students must have a science background, including degrees such as MBBS, BDS, BAMS, BPharm, MPharm, or DPharma etc. Other degrees health science related are also eligible.

  • Candidates must have obtained a minimum of 50 to 55% in their previous studies.

  • English proficiency (IELTS/DET/TOEFL/PTE)

  • GRE Scores (If required)

  • Prior work experience in healthcare or clinical research is not required, but some universities might ask for it.

  • Additional documents (LOR, SOP, resume)

Course duration

Up to 1 year

Top specialisations

  • Clinical Trials Management

  • Biostatistics

  • Pharmacovigilance

Top job roles

  • Trial Coordinator

  • Clinical Research Associate

  • Regulatory Affairs Executive

MSc in Medical Lab Technology (MLT)

Particulars

Details

Eligibility

  • Candidates often require a relevant bachelor's degree in MLT or a related field such as biology, biochemistry, or life science. Candidates with MBBS degrees are also eligible.

  • Minimum GPA required is generally 50 to 60%.

  • There might be an entrance exam or interview requirements

  • English proficiency (DET/PTE/TOEFL/IELTS)

  • Additional documents (resume, SOP, LOR)

Course duration

2 years

Top specialisations

  • Molecular Diagnostics

  • Clinical Biochemistry

  • Hematology

Top job roles

  • Lab Technologist

  • Pathology Lab Manager

  • QA Analyst

MSc in Psychology / Clinical Psychology

Particulars

Details

Eligibility

  • Candidates must have a relevant undergraduate degree in Psychology. An MBBS degree is also acceptable for admission.

  • A strong academic record with a minimum if 55% of generally required.

  • English proficiency (PTE/IELTS/TOEFL/DET)

  • Additional documents (LOR, resume, SOP)

  • GRE might be required

  • Work experience (If required)

Course duration

2 years

Top specialisations

  • Counseling Psychology

  • Neuropsychology

  • Developmental Psychology

Top job roles

  • Clinical Psychologist

  • Counselor

  • Mental Health Educator

2. Which country does not require the FMGE exam?

Countries such as USA, UK, Canada, and Australia have their own licensure exam. Hence, Indian students, after completing their MBBS, are not required to clear the FMGE exam to practice medicine there. For say, the USMLE in USA, MCCQE in Canada, PLAB in UK, and AMC in Australia are popular medical licensing exams.

3. How many attempts can we give for FMGE?

There is no officially stated restriction on the FMGE exam reappearing. Candidates who have failed the exam can appear for the next session. There are two FMGE exam sessions in a year: June and December.
